Narrative:Following a loss of engine power, the aircraft, an experimental David Patrick Stewart built Van's RV-8, impacted multiple objects during the subsequent force landing near the Horseshoe Bay Resort Airport (KDZB), Horseshoe Bay, Texas. The airplane was substantially damaged and the two occupants onboard received unspecified injuries.
